Anna Ross on Europeans fervour and how team efforts bring stars together
-
WHAT a competition the Europeans have been: the highest standard I’ve ever witnessed. After Britain bagged the team gold medal, there were only four people feeling under pressure for the grand prix special and freestyle… the rest of us could just sit back and enjoy their rides.
It’s always more exciting when the outcome doesn’t seem inevitable and although the favourite prevailed, there was a battle royale for the gold medals. The Brits were outstanding – I’m going to put it out there and say Lottie Fry was my freestyle winner.
Seeing all the British blue T-shirts led me to reflect on how many people actually make up a British team. It’s easy to think it’s just four riders, but in reality the team is the front line with an army behind. The army is not just those on the battlefield – or the field of play, as it’s known in sport – but is made up of owners, grooms, vets, farriers, saddle fitters, breeders, parents, partners, supporters and many others who help bring the riders and horses together.
